Job title: Staff AI Scientist
Location: Mountain View, CA – Onsite
Mode: contract
Job Overview:
We are building the future of financial technology through the power of AI and generative AI.
We are seeking an innovative and hands-on Staff AI Scientist to join our AI team. In this role, you will design, build, and deploy AI solutions that empower businesses, leveraging both traditional machine learning and cutting-edge GenAI approaches.
As a senior technical leader, you will shape Customer’s AI strategy, mentor teams, and ensure that our AI solutions are scalable, responsible, and directly impactful to customers.
You will collaborate across product, engineering, and design to deliver intelligent experiences that transform how customers manage their finances.
Responsibilities
• Practices leadership and communication skills to influence teams and to evangelize data science across the organization
• Collaborates with stakeholders to define success criteria and align model metrics with business goals. Works side-by-side with product managers, software engineers, and designers in designing experiments and minimum viable products
• Leads technical work of a scrum team: initiating and designing model solutions, driving end-to-end architecture designs of the team’s work, and holding the team accountable for high quality code, git, design, costs and implementation standards
• Performs hands-on data analysis and modeling with large data sets, including discovering data sources, getting data access, cleaning up data, and making them “model-ready”. You need to be willing and able to do your own ETL and design/build featurization.
• Applies data mining, NLP, and machine learning (such as supervised/unsupervised, Causal-ML, Online Learning, Bayesian Learning, Reinforcement Learning, or Deep Learning) to real-world problems and datasets.
• Communicates with partners to ensure successful delivery and integration of AI solutions
• Proactively researches, explores, and enables new AI/ML. Keeps up with the new developments in academia and industry and considers possible extensions to solve our customer problems.
• Tracks academic + industry trends; adopts Multimodal LLMs, Agentic AI
• Designs and deploys LLM-powered solutions using Amazon Bedrock (Claude, Titan), Azure OpenAI, or Databricks DBRX — including RAG pipelines, prompt engineering, and fine-tuning
• Designs A/B tests, monitors drift via CloudWatch / Lakehouse Monitoring
• Builds RAG pipelines, LLM apps on Bedrock, Claude, Databricks
• Evaluates models using MLflow, LLM Evaluate + RAGAS
• Partners with Cloud Architects on AWS/Azure cost, security, and design standards
Qualifications
• BS, MS, or PhD in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, Economics, Operations Research, or related field.
• 6+ years of industry experience in applied data science/AI, with a proven track record of delivering production ML/AI solutions.
• Deep knowledge of ML paradigms (supervised/unsupervised learning, reinforcement learning, Bayesian methods, causal inference, deep learning).
• Expertise in NLP and GenAI: transformers, LLMs, prompt engineering, embeddings, RAG, evaluation frameworks.
• Proficiency in Python and modern ML/AI libraries (TensorFlow, PyTorch, etc.).
• Ability to influence technical strategy and product direction across teams.
• Strong communication and presentation skills; able to explain complex concepts to technical and non-technical audiences.
• Experience mentoring junior scientists/engineers and fostering a culture of excellence.
